Transaction fc0382fe728a046199be91f99e3a7a666605501c7054bac2956035a62e88f7fb
1 Input
1 Output
-
fc0382fe728a046199be91f99e3a7a666605501c7054bac2956035a62e88f7fb:0
- value
- 11346406
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cca19f1104ff403e62432983e7072fc871acf645 OP_EQUAL
- address
- MSZ9hDFkvzfZ2RWpFaEfwUvfDTHpa6SSqY